121/*
122 * df_name_compare() is identical to base_name_compare(), except it
123 * compares conflicting directory/file entries as equal. Note that
124 * while a directory name compares as equal to a regular file, they
125 * then individually compare _differently_ to a filename that has
126 * a dot after the basename (because '\0' < '.' < '/').
127 *
128 * This is used by routines that want to traverse the git namespace
129 * but then handle conflicting entries together when possible.
130 */
